Solution for 3(x-1)-13=-25 equation:



3(x-1)-13=-25
We move all terms to the left:
3(x-1)-13-(-25)=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
3(x-1)+12=0
We multiply parentheses
3x-3+12=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
3x+9=0
We move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right
3x=-9
x=-9/3
x=-3
